Covid-19 sample collection booths ibutang tibuok nasud

April 19, 2020 by NewsLine Philippines

DAVAO CITY — Ang Department of Science and Technology (DOST) magbutang og mga 132 ka sample specimen collecting booths sa tibuok nasud aron pagtabang sa pag-testing sa katawhan para coronavirus disease (Covid-19).

Si Cabinet Secretary Karlo Nograles nag-ingon nga ang pagbutang of mga specimen collection booths gituyo aron mapun-an ang 16 ka mga Covid-19 testing centers sa nasud nga accredited sa Department of Health (DOH).

Ang mga regional office sa DOST makigtambayayong sa DOH alang sa pagbutang og mga sample collecting booths sa matag rehiyon sa Pilipinas.

Sa usa ka post sa Facebook, gipahibalo ni DOST Secretary Fortunato dela Peña nga mga 34 ka specimen collection booth ang ibutang sa Metro Manila.

Magbutang usab og 10 ka collection booth sa Zamboanga Peninsula, walo sa Central Luzon, ug pito sa Central Visayas.

Tag-unom ka collection booth ang ibutang sa Cordillera Administrative Region, Ilocos Region, Cagayan Valley, ug Western Visayas.

Sa Bicol Region ug Northern Mindanao magbutang og tag-lima ka collection booth, samtang sa Calabarzon, Davao Region, ug Caraga Region butangan og tag-upat.

Magbutang usab og tag-tulo ka specimen collection booth sa Eastern Visayas ug Soccksargen, samtang duha ang ibutang sa Mimaropa.

“Aming ilalabas ang mga karagdagang detalye ng mga napiling pasilidad na mapagkalooban ng mga collection booths sa mga susunod na araw,” pulong pa ni dela Peña.

Ang Pilipinas kasamtangang adunay 16 ka mga Covid-19 testing center nga accredited sa DOH.

Sa Metro Manila ang mga testing laboratory naa sa UP National Institutes of Health ug San Lazaro Hospital sa Manila; Philippine Red Cross ug Detoxicare Molecular Diagnostics Laboratory sa Mandaluyong; Lung Center of the Philippines, St. Luke’s Medical Center ug Victoriano Luna Hospital sa Quezon City; The Medical City sa Pasig; Makati Medical Center; St. Luke’s Medical Center sa Taguig; ug Research Institute for Tropical Medicine sa Muntinlupa.

Ang mga otorisadong testing center gawas sa Metro Manila naa sa Baguio General hospital and Medical Center, Vicente Sotto Memorial Medical Center sa Cebu, Southern Philippines Medical Center sa Davao, Western Visayas Medical Center sa Iloilo, ug sa Bicol Diagnostic and Reference Laboratory sa Legazpi City.

Pulong pa ni Nograles nga daghan pang mga testing laboratory ang pagabuksan human sila makakuha og sertipikasyon gikan sa DOH.

Suportado sa Inter-Ageny Task Force for the Management of Emerging Infectious Diseases (IATF-EID) ang pag-accredit sa tanang testing laboratory sa nasud, apil na ang naa sa Marikina City.

“As a general rule, the IATF fully supports the establishment and accreditation of all testing laboratories in the Philippines that will help us increase our testing capabilities and capacities. Necessarily, kasama na po diyan yung sa Marikina. Kaunti na lang at ma-accredit na sila,” sulti ni Nograles, nga kinsa usab nagsilbing tigpamaba sa IATF-EID. (LBG)
